I came here with 4 others (2 Spurs fans) Bank Holiday Monday night shortly before Charlton's last home game of the season (7 May). Considering the Addicks relegation, it was a poignant pre match drink for me given my pre match pessimism.

Anyway, this place was packed of Spurs fans being the main "away" boozer when visiting Charlton. Needed to show tickets to enter. The "pumping" music playing in here gave the feel of being in a night club as opposed to going to a football match. Wooden décor was very basic, with sticky floor where we were standing, but we just wanted a quick drink so did not really care.

Decent enough boozer for away fans though when visiting the Valley, conveniently located a stone throw away from Charlton station. I am sure those supporters of Cardiff, Stoke and Burnley, for instance, will enjoy this place if they come to the Charlton game next season…

This bar has recently undergone a great new re-furb -- it is now equipped with leather sofas, fully stocked bar, pool table, open fireplace and flat screens. The bar is large, so it means you can go off to a different area if you are a non-smoker. The staff is great, and there is always a great atmosphere. It also has a bed & breakfast should you have too much to drink and need a place to stay! Highly recommended.
